"textContent": "The Astana Times provides news and information from Kazakhstan and around the world.\n\nALMATY — The government must move quickly to bring legislation into line with Kazakhstan’s new Constitution by adopting five new constitutional laws, amendments to eight existing constitutional laws, and changes to more than 60 laws, including codes, Prime Minister Olzhas Bektenov said at a March 18 government meeting on implementing the new Basic Law. “The…\n\nThe post Government to Overhaul Legal Framework Following New Constitution appeared first on The Astana Times.",
